About This Item
NY: Illustrated Editions Co. and Three Sirens Press, 1932. 8vo.; brown cloth covered boards, hardcover; 228 pages with deckled edges; former owner's bookplate on front endpaper and his name is stamped on half title page; corner on title page is torn off else very good.
